Had a minor incident with a couple of boxes falling off of a truck and getting hit and running over them. The trucking company's insurance company provided me an appraisal but said it could be higher "since it is a Tesla"

Needs a new windshield and a bunch of minor repainting to, well, everything upfront. Their current estimate is about $2800.

Also, was 2 days old.

So two questions...

1 - Is this something that the local Service Center can and should do?

2 - What should I be worried about as far as the repairs etc.

I'm here in Jax too. If you dont live too far from the service center on Phillips hwy I recommend stopping there and asking one of the service writers what they recommend. They can do the windshield for sure and have a great detail guy that used to be a painter for BMW so he will have good insight too.
 
Got a reply from the service center:

"Unfortunately at our facility we are limited to only replacing front and rear pre-painted bumpers from the factory. We do not have a painting facility here. We recommend taking your vehicle to a Tesla Approved body shop. We have used Joe Hudsons on Tresca RD off of Atlantic blvd with good results. They order everything directly from our warehouses and are familiar with repair procedures."

I'll give them a call this week and bring it in.
